I don't think there will be a way to skip images as that is kind of the whole point of the template for most people using it (you can create a page type template that has another area above the "Main" area where you could put the images though).

As for the styling, you would have to make sure the same CSS styles are being applied on the page with the Page List block as on the page with the content itself -- there's no way to automatically bring this over from the page unless the theme template has the styles set up to work on both pages.

Thank you for your feedback -- I never did take this down because I looked at the number of downloads and it's actually quite high. Just goes to show you that you always hear from the people who need help, but rarely from people who are not having any problems (which I completely understand).

And I agree that for many simple blogging purposes, the built-in blog functionality works just fine (this addon was actually taken from an older version of the C5 built-in blog that I worked on a while ago, so they're related). But it's not pointless to have more full-featured blog tools because some people prefer to have something that "works like wordpress" (where you go to a separate dashboard to write new posts, instead of to the page itself like with C5), and also some people have more complicated requirements with things like workflow, approval dates, multiple levels of categories, etc.
